2011 Chevrolet Equinox Bolt Pattern
Checking fitment for your vehicle? Below you will find the factory bolt pattern (also known as the lug pattern) for the 2011 Chevrolet Equinox, along with offset and center bore data.
| Bolt Pattern (Lug Pattern) | 5x120 |
|---|---|
| Lug Nut / Bolt Size | N 14x1.50 |
| Center Bore (CB) | 66.6 mm |
| Offset (ET) | 42 |
| Torque Specs | 100 ft-lbs (135 Nm) |
2011 Equinox — Year-Specific Fitment Context
The 2011 model year marks the beginning of the Chevrolet Equinox's 5x120 bolt pattern era, which continued through 2018 (8 consecutive years). Wheels from any 2011–2018 Chevrolet Equinox are cross-compatible with the 2011 model. Note: the 2010 model used a different pattern (5x115), so its wheels are NOT interchangeable with the 2011. Across its full production run (2005–2024), the Equinox has also used: 5x115.

Expert Buying Guide for 2011 Chevrolet Equinox
When selecting aftermarket wheels for your 2011 Chevrolet Equinox, the center bore of 66.6mm is critical. Many aftermarket wheels have a larger bore (e.g., 73.1mm), requiring hub-centric rings to prevent vibrations and ensure proper load transfer. The offset is sensitive: the factory spec is 42mm, but a range of 35-45mm is acceptable. Going outside this range may cause rubbing on suspension or fenders. Always use lug nuts with the correct thread pitch (14x1.50) and seat type (conical/60-degree). Using incorrect lug nuts can lead to wheel loosening. For safety, verify that aftermarket wheels are load-rated for your vehicle's weight.

2011 Chevrolet Equinox — Frequently Asked Questions
What is the bolt pattern for a 2011 Chevrolet Equinox?
The 2011 Chevrolet Equinox uses a 5x120 bolt pattern (also called lug pattern or PCD). The center bore is 66.6mm and the offset is 42mm.
What other years of Chevrolet Equinox have the same bolt pattern as the 2011?
The Chevrolet Equinox uses the 5x120 pattern from 2011 through 2018. Wheels from any of these model years are dimensionally compatible with the 2011, provided the offset and center bore also match.
Can I use 2010 Chevrolet Equinox wheels on a 2011?
No. The 2010 Equinox used a 5x115 bolt pattern, which differs from the 2011's 5x120. They are not interchangeable.
How tight should I torque the lug nuts on a 2011 Chevrolet Equinox?
Refer to your owner's manual for exact specs, but always tighten the N 14x1.50 hardware in a star or crisscross pattern. Re-torque after the first 50 miles of driving.
How do I measure the bolt pattern on my 2011 Chevrolet?
The 2011 Equinox uses a 5x120 pattern. For 4, 6, or 8-lug wheels, measure center-to-center across opposite holes. For 5-lug, measure from the center of one hole to the back of the opposite hole.
Can I use spacers on my 2011 Chevrolet Equinox?
Yes, but ensure the wheel spacers match the 5x120 bolt pattern and 66.6mm center bore. Also verify that you have enough thread engagement for your N 14x1.50 hardware.
